Click ‘Get Form’ to open it in the editor.
Begin by entering your Loan Identification Number, State Code, County Code, and Loan Number in the designated fields.
Fill in your name, address (including ZIP code), Tax Identification Number (last 4 digits), and telephone number.
Specify the requested loan amount and indicate if this is a FSFL Microloan request. Choose the desired loan term from the options provided.
Select the commodity type(s) relevant to your application by checking all applicable boxes.
Indicate the facility or equipment type needed for storage based on your selected commodities. Provide a description of the facility or equipment in section 6A.
Complete sections regarding legal descriptions, lien information, and certifications as required. Ensure all signatures are obtained before submission.

What is the maximum farm storage facility loan amount?
FSFL is an excellent financing option to address on-farm storage and handling needs for small and mid-sized farms, and for new farmers and ranchers. Loan terms vary from three to 12 years. The maximum loan amount for storage facilities is $500,000. The maximum loan amount for storage and handling trucks is $100,000.
How to get a loan for a storage facility?
One of the best financing options for self-storage owners are SBA 504 loans. They are an especially good option for operators that arent able to qualify for conventional financing. The 504 loan provides long-term, fixed-rate financing of up to $5 million for buying, building or rehabbing a self-storage facility.
